Mondi and Meurer introduce new paper solution for coffee packaging

Mondi’s TrayWrap: A sustainable paper packaging solution for coffee bundles.

 

Mondi, a global leader in sustainable packaging and paper, has developed a new secondary paper packaging solution, TrayWrap, for wrapping bundles of food and drinks. This new solution replaces the plastic shrink film traditionally used in the industry.

 

The TrayWrap, made with Mondi’s Advantage StretchWrap, is now being used by a coffee brand to secure 12 coffee packages for transportation across Sweden. The paper wrap holds the coffee packs in place with 4-6 adhesive dots on the bottom of the existing corrugated tray. Pre-punched folding points provide stability on each open side, allowing products to be seen, stacked, transported, and easily unpacked for sale.

 

Advantage StretchWrap, made from 100% kraft paper from renewable resources, is fully recyclable and can be easily disposed of in Europe’s existing paper recycling streams. The paper exhibits high strength, excellent puncture resistance, and good stretchability, making it suitable for grouped packaging applications and meeting future European regulatory requirements.

 

Mondi has collaborated closely with Meurer to adapt existing machinery to accommodate the new solution. The technology used for TrayWrap is similar to that for film, enabling food and drink producers to modify their processes without investing in new machines. Independent testing has proven the effectiveness of this solution.

 

Meurer’s latest Paper Hood Machine (PHM) employs in-line paper technology that handles a wide range of paper qualities, including Mondi’s Advantage StretchWrap, and various tray formats efficiently.
